The two most widespread varieties of 3D printing filaments are ABS and PLA. ABS is oil-based and is created using petroleum, while PLA is a plant-based polymer. PLA might be a better choice for you if you prefer an environment-friendly option. Vegetable waste that primarily comes from corn, sugar beets, sugar can and soy is what it is made from. PLA filament is biodegradable and because it is made from waste materials, it does not place a demand or a strain on the natural environment it comes from. The specific environment you are working is also an essential consideration when you're making the choice between ABS and PLA. If the air temperature is cold where you are printing, you really should go with PLA filament because ABS is a lot more likely to crack or warp when it’s cold. On the other hand, PLA is more prone to overheating issues and it can warp and droop when it is exposed to too much heat or sunlight. Always make sure to limit the amount of moisture in your printing environment no matter the type of filament for 3D printers you use because both kinds of filament can be damaged by excessive moisture. What is the use of 3D printing for your organization? Whatever function you identify will dictate the filament choice. PLA adheres more strongly to a number of surfaces while ABS filament is more flexible. If you require your product to bend you will likely want ABS because PLA is more likely to break if it is bent an excessive amount. For functional items including tools and parts of machines, ABS is fantastic. If you're utilizing your 3D printing capabilities in a medical context, PLA is a great choice since it is bioresorbable, meaning it is friendly to the human body; the body breaks it down and absorbs it as time passes. PLA is currently being used as a material for arterial stents and other implants. If you're printing items in a small, enclosed space, it may be worth taking into consideration the kinds of fumes generated by the heated plastic filament your printers are using. ABS filament has unpleasant fumes while when PLA is used, there's a rather pleasant smell. Large businesses that use 3D printing in areas like engineering typically choose ABS filament because they are more interested in functionality than with the scent of fumes. People who are put off by the fumes from ABS filament may prefer PLA if they are experimenting with 3D printing at home.
